WebHumanism is a progressive philosophy of life based on a profound respect for human dignity and the conviction that human beings are ultimately accountable to themselves and to society for their actions. It is a secular worldview that affirms our ability and responsibility to lead ethical and meaningful lives. WebA Humanist Creed. I believe in the real world and in people. I believe in beauty and in the beauty of truth. I believe in separating myth from reality. I believe that people can solve their problems by using imagination and common sense applied with courage and by following basic moral principles. I want to make peace, democracy, and well-being ...
